The overview below groups typical Sidewalk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Denver County,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Repair Costs - The cost to repair sidewalks varies based on the extent of damage, typically ranging from $300 to $1,200 for minor repairs. Larger cracks or sections may cost between $1,200 and $3,500. Prices can differ depending on the local contractor and specific project requirements.
Replacement Expenses - Replacing sections of damaged sidewalk generally costs between $4,000 and $8,000 for standard-sized areas. Larger or more complex projects, such as full replacement of a sidewalk segment, can reach $10,000 or more. Local service providers can provide estimates based on project scope.
Material & Labor Fees - Costs for materials and labor typically account for a significant portion of sidewalk repair, with average expenses around $5 to $15 per square foot. Premium materials or specialized repair methods may increase overall costs. Local pros can offer detailed quotes tailored to specific needs.
Additional Charges - Extra costs may include permits, debris removal, or site preparation, which can add $500 to $2,000 to the total. These charges depend on project size and local regulations, and service providers can clarify potential additional fees during consultation.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
